One mach number is equal to
A. \[1Km{{s}^{-1}}\]
B. \[1{N}/{{{m}^{2}}}\;\]
C. velocity of light
D. speed of sound

Hint: Mach number is the comparison of the speed of an object to the speed of the sound in a medium given by the equation, \[Mach\text{ }no=\dfrac{u}{v}\]. Mach no= 1 means the object and sound share the same speed. Speed of sound in air is considered as 1234.8 kmph

Complete Step-by-Step solution:
Fluids are forms of matter that deforms easily under continuous stress. As we know liquids, gases and plasma together form fluids. The study of the motion of these three together is known as fluid dynamics.

Or in simple words, let us consider an aircraft is flying at an altitude ‘a’. Then Mach number is nothing but the ratio of the speed of the aircraft moving in the medium to the speed of sound in the undisturbed medium through which it is travelling.
Mach speed is considered when an object moves faster than the speed of sound. Since Mach number is the ratio between two velocities, it is a dimensionless quantity. There are some factors that affect the value of Mach number like temperature, density, altitude etc.
Mach number = speed of airplane in the medium / speed of sound in the undisturbed medium i.e.,
Mach number = \[\dfrac{u}{v}\]……….(1)
where u is the speed of the aircraft in the medium
and v is the speed of sound through the medium.
Mach numbers are widely used in order to compare the speed of the moving objects through fluids such as aircrafts. If the Mach number is one, it implies that the object is moving with speed of the sound.

By categorizing the value of Mach number, aircrafts are broadly classified into
Subsonic – Mach no<1.0 eg. Helicopter
Transonic – Mach no~1.0 eg. Civilian aircraft
Supersonic- Mach no>1.0 eg. Modern fighter aircraft, missiles
Hypersonic- Mach no >5.0 eg. Space craft
